Does this sound like you? Then read on…#LI-hybrid Responsibilities The role you’re interested in… The successful candidate will be a technical expert in high protein RTD product development. This scientist will be a key resource for our R&I teams to ensure robust technical understanding and validation of innovation, renovation projects and new formulations. As a SME, this position is an internal technical resource/consultant for various R&I scientists and team members and strongly influences or oversees execution of several Strategic Initiatives (SIs). This role will be instrumental in enhancing technical know-how for the R&I development team. This position leads SI and cross-functional initiatives and is a key link between R&D, internal technical functions, and external partners. This position works with limited supervision and has accountability for significant decisions that drive category growth made jointly with senior leadership in R&I and other functions. Qualifications What are we looking for? Education: BS in Food Science, Food Engineering, Chemical Engineering or similar disciplines. Note: Highly relevant hands-on experience can supplant required traditional academic preparation. Experience: 12+ years’ experience in Food industry, which includes substantial experience in R&D, New Product Development, Product Commercialization, Project Management and/or product/process improvement experience. 5+ years’ experience with dairy protein RTD beverages. Substantial experience influencing other developers. Success in matrixed organizations that require working in cross-functional teams and with external technical resources is required. Skills and mindset: Strong fundamental experience in dairy protein RTD beverages product development. Demonstrated ability to plan, execute and analyze robust experiments to answer business relevant questions and clearly communicate/document recommendations. Demonstrated ability to execute and/or oversee execution of projects within timelines and meet/exceed project targets. Demonstrated ability to work effectively in dynamic technical team environments (cross-functional teams, both internal and external resources) through excellent interpersonal, influencing and communication skills (both written and verbal). Demonstrated ability to effectively influence other scientists and aptitude for technical mentorship. Ability to excel in fast-paced business environment, demonstrated ability to self-motivate and manage multiple priorities. Ability to travel up to 20% to various sites e.g., project exploration/implementation at third parties/co-manufacturers. Ability to lift ______________ and work with bulk ingredients.
